Cold Start Injector: Service and Repair
Spray Bar Assembly:
1. Remove flexible fuel throttle body.
2. Remove two bolts retaining Cold Start Injector (CSI) spray bar assembly to throttle body.
3. Remove CSI and gasket from throttle body.
4. Using a 1/4 inch allen wrench, remove plug located on throttle body opposite CSI mounting surface.
CAUTION: Use care when installing spray bar to throttle body. DO NOT FORCE. Damage to CSI and spray bar assembly will occur.
5. Install CSI and spray bar assembly with new gasket to throttle body, with end of spray bar assembly resting in support grommet located behind plug in throttle body casting.
6. Align CSI to throttle body and install retainer bolts. Tighten bolts to 8-11 Nm (70-97 lb in).
7. Verify end of spray bar is resting in support grommet. If not, repeat Steps 1 through 6.
8. Apply pipe sealant with Teflon� D8AZ-19544-A (ESG-M4G 194-A) or equivalent in a clockwise direction to plug. Install plug in throttle body. Tighten plug to 10-15 Nm (7-11 lb ft).
9. Reinstall throttle body. Inspect for leaks with engine running.
